Casa de Benavidez - Albuquerque, NM

This Albuquerque institution is the home of the Sopapilla Burger, a generous green chile cheeseburger that uses puffy sopapillas instead of a traditional bun. Also of note is the foot-long chili dog that’s smothered in cheese and red chile sauce. Casa de Benavidez offers a full range of New Mexican specialties for breakfast, lunch, and dinner.
